Shell upgrades and background sessions

Sometimes, we don't need to interact with the compromised host on the fly. In such situations, we can instruct Metasploit to background the newly created session as soon as a service is exploited using the -z switch, as follows:

As we can see that we have a command shell opened, it is always desirable to have better-controlled access like the one provided by Meterpreter. In such scenarios, we can upgrade the session using the -u switch, as shown in the following screenshot:
